AI can just steal my territory? by Wendigo-boyo in HumankindTheGame

[–]Dream8808 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Most of everyone hit the nail on the head here. IF the enemy is an expansionist culture - their ability is "under one banner" i believe which means they can pretty much just walk up and take your stuff :)

typically there is a timer though, similar to when being ransacked, but the timer is dependent on how strong the army is.

You CAN avoid this though. Make sure your admin building is connected to your main plaza via districts and you have any type of wall infrastructure. If you do this, no one can use the ability on that location because it would be considered "in your city" at that point.

this does not work for outposts though as its not your territory, only "claimed" territory.

The other option is what the studios said!
If youre a vassal, whomever your under, receives all grievances that you produce toward all other nations. So if they give into their demands - you unfortunately cannot do anything about that. Unless of course - you fight back against the big man! (or woman)

Should I be placing all my districts in one territory? by nevrtouchedgrass in HumankindTheGame

[–]Dream8808 1 point2 points  (0 children)

in the beginning of the game its best to choose what gives the best yields and focus mostly on your unique districts.

by the time you make it to the 3rd era, you do want to have your buildings connect to each city center as that is the only way to defend the city and have places for your home defense to spawn.

Otherwise, any army can just go to your city center and destroy/capture it with only one unit spawning.

If you like big mega cities, focus on commons quarters and allow them to separate your districts.
For instance, if you know your going for a food area, place the commons quarter in the middle surround it with food. Then on the other side, of your food district place another commons quarter, to where as half is surrounded by food and the other half will start the section of your next district set (ei makers quarter)

If you strategically build your city this way, you will have great yield multipliers and your city will grow very fast while generating lots of influence and keeping your stability manageable.
if you build this way, you cannot always place where the game suggests. The game only suggests whats good for a one time placement, it does not know what youre necessarily trying to build toward.
